JOB SUMMARY Perform inspection, testing and repair of fire sprinkler and kitchen systems with knowledge of multiple manufacturers’ products. Provide accurate and detailed inspections reports with all proper documentation of improvements and complications. Perform inspections on large projects. JOB RESPONSIBILITIES Perform routine inspections, testing and services of life safety product lines with minimal supervision. Responsible for operating with minimal supervision while performing fire protection inspections Daily communications with Project Manager and/or Schedule Coordinator on inspection or project delays, requirements and general status of job. Work with Project Manager, Schedule Coordinator and Office Administrative Staff to ensure complete closeout and turnover of jobs to the client. JOB REQUIREMENTS Must be willing or possess other applicable state licenses Strong working knowledge of life safety and NFPA codes Working knowledge of sprinkler controls, alarm panels, devices and critical components Perform testing and maintenance on sprinkler and fire pump systems PREFERRED EXPERIENCE Coordinate between inspection deficiencies and service required to correct found deficiencies Capability to present information and respond to questions from managers, customers, AHJs (Authorities Having Jurisdiction) and the general public Able to complete documentation and administrative duties as necessary; proficient in the use of personal computers and Microsoft Office tools Must work in an efficient manner Demonstrated competency in verbal and written business communication skills.
